That's right. Office 2007 Ribbon UI for
ASP.NET. In what is the absolute best implementation of the Ribbon UI I have seen on the web to date, Russel Masson has contributed
an outstanding project
to the Telerik Code Library. The project, which will likely become a
Telerik Open Source Project soon, provides everything you need to
implement the Office 2007 Ribbon UI in an ASP.NET application. The
project includes a number of custom Ribbon controls built by Russel
that work closely with the Telerik RadControls to work their magic.
You
must check out the
online demo
to understand the quality of this implementation. This is much more
than a Ribbon UI skin for Telerik controls (though it is a good skin,
too). This is a full platform for implementing the Ribbon UI.
